Role Description
Hygienist
Brackley House, Brackley Street, Farnworth BL4 9ES
Embark on an exciting career journey at Brackley House located in Bolton, 5-minute drive off the M60 ring road and 1 mile from the train station with free outside parking. Our practice serves the community with care and support and has a long-standing patients base. Our clinicians are longstanding and genuinely care about their patients. Our practice specialises in sedation, implants, and uses advanced equipment including iTero scanner and OPG to support with diagnostics. The clinic operates on a mixed NHS and private patient model which is supported by a treatment coordinator and experienced clinicians. We have 12 surgeries in Brackley House all on the ground floor. We use working feedback for our patients and currently have a 5-star rating which is down to all the team caring about each and everyone who comes through our door. Brackley is a very modern dental practice and offers both a private waiting room and NHS waiting room.
